unwritten
adj 1: based on custom rather than documentation; "an unwritten
law"; "rites...so ancient that they well might have had
their unwritten origins in Aurignacian times"-
J.L.T.C.Spence [ant: {written}]
2: using speech rather than writing; "an oral tradition"; "an
oral agreement" [synonym: {oral}, {unwritten}]
3: said or done without having been planned or written in
advance; "he made a few ad-lib remarks" [synonym: {ad-lib},
{spontaneous}, {unwritten}]

Unwritten \Un*writ"ten\, a.
1. Not written; not reduced to writing; oral; as, unwritten
agreements.
[1913 Webster]

2. Containing no writing; blank; as, unwritten paper.
[1913 Webster]

{Unwritten doctrines} (Theol.), such doctrines as have been
handed down by word of mouth; oral or traditional
doctrines.

{Unwritten law}. [Cf. L. lex non scripta.] That part of the
law of England and of the United States which is not
derived from express legislative enactment, or at least
from any enactment now extant and in force as such. This
law is now generally contained in the reports of judicial
decisions. See {Common law}, under {Common}.

{Unwritten laws}, such laws as have been handed down by
tradition or in song. Such were the laws of the early
nations of Europe.
[1913 Webster]
